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79013 83229 56 94790917063
04309544 6256951
04309544 6256951
85787 51392 5513 44934 35469
All about undefined
Interested in learning more?
04309544 6256951
85787 51392 5513 44934 35469
See more
6370 794
2912 1921264 80
See more
803197 077459292 89263477180
89193238 683963176 874030916 5715550
See more